In Loving Memory of Earlene Mcinroe

Earlene Mclnroe, aged 87, joined her beloved husband, Olen Hugh, in Heaven on Tuesday, 11 February 2025. She had been in a memory care facility in Fort Worth, Texas, since 2022. Earlene was born on Tuesday, 22 June 1937, in Stephenville, Texas. She graduated from Stephenville High School as salutatorian on Monday, 30 May 1955. Earlene married Olen Hugh Mclnroe on Saturday, 29 October 1955, in Stephenville, Texas. They were married for almost fifty years. They lived in Blue Mound, Texas, for the majority of their marriage. Earlene was an avid baker, gardener, and reader. She was a homemaker who worked diligently to care for her husband and children. She was a long-time member of Saginaw Park Baptist Church. Throughout the years, she worked in the nursery, sang in the choir, and taught Sunday School.

Earlene will be interred at Huckabay Cemetery in Huckabay, Texas.
